§ 4729.10

Effective: April 6, 2017 Latest Legislation: Senate Bill 319 - 131st General Assembly The state board of pharmacy may adopt rules under section 4729.26 of the Revised Code requiring a licensee or registrant under this chapter to report to the board a violation of state or federal law, including any rule adopted under this chapter. In the absence of fraud or bad faith, a person who reports under this section or testifies in any adjudication conducted under Chapter 119. of the Revised Code is not liable to any person for damages in a civil action as a result of the report or testimony.
